Output 3f79583f8315ac54bfe91ae8bcfb9e4e4aeca6c18ec97422ceb6516cc339c29c:1

value
58500000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d6bf51beae65071670d6fcb0a7a295273f45064c OP_EQUAL
address
3MGVihEncoGooXCjyfBbGKKj6nm4gkXjLe
transaction
3f79583f8315ac54bfe91ae8bcfb9e4e4aeca6c18ec97422ceb6516cc339c29c
spent
true